In this research we are examined metal materials printed on digital Ink-Jet printing machine Durst Rho 750. The test card was printed on three metal materials, 3-4 mm of thickness. Based on the analysis of optical density, relative spectral reflection, volume and surface of lines, color differences and L * a * b * values, we came to know how these parameters change under the influence of rubbing. The results are presented through tables and charts.
